网站可以使用多种编程语言进行开发,具体选择哪种编程语言取决于开发者的需求和技能。以下是一些常见的网站开发编程语言:
HTML/CSS/JavaScript
HTML(超文本标记语言):用于定义网页的结构和内容。
CSS(层叠样式表):用于控制网页的样式和布局。
JavaScript:用于实现网页的交互功能,如动画、表单验证和页面加载等。
后端开发编程语言
PHP:一种服务器端脚本语言,广泛用于开发动态网站和Web应用程序。
Python:一种通用的高级编程语言,有丰富的Web开发框架,如Django和Flask。
Ruby:一种面向对象的编程语言,通过Ruby on Rails等框架可以快速开发高效的网站。
Java:一种面向对象的编程语言,广泛应用于网站开发。
C:微软开发的一种面向对象的编程语言,适合用于开发Windows平台的网站和应用程序。
其他编程语言和框架
ASP(Active Server Pages):用于创建动态交互式网页。
ASP.NET:基于.NET Framework的Web应用程序框架,提供强大的开发工具。
JSP(Java Server Pages):基于Java的Web应用程序技术,用于生成动态内容。
WordPress:一个广泛使用的博客和CMS程序,适合内容发布和网站管理。
Drupal、 Joomla、 WordPress:这些是流行的CMS系统,用于构建企业网站和内容管理系统。
建议
初学者:可以从HTML、CSS和JavaScript开始,逐步学习PHP或Python等后端语言。
有经验的开发者:可以根据项目需求选择合适的编程语言和框架,如Django、Flask、Ruby on Rails等。
企业级应用:可以考虑使用Java、C或ASP.NET等更强大的后端技术,结合前端技术实现复杂的功能。
选择合适的编程语言和技术栈,可以提高开发效率,确保网站的性能和安全性。